摘要
结合震害调查与经验总结,通过选取具有一定代表性的八个多层现浇混凝土框架结构电算模型,探讨了楼梯对多层框架结构的整体刚度和层间位移角的影响,研究中发现:楼梯的斜撑作用使得多层框架的实际刚度有所增加,在结构设计工作中应在建模时尽量模拟实际状况考虑楼梯斜撑对结构的影响。
Combining with the investigation of earthquake disasters and the experience summery,the paper explores the influence of stairs on the general stiffness and the angle of floor displacement of multi-floor frame structure by selecting the electric accounting model of some representative eight multi-floor cast-in-place concrete frame structure,and finds that the sprag can increase the factual stiffness of the multi-floor frame,and the sprag of stairs on the structure should be considered in the simulation of the model in the structural design.
